Arthur J. Gallagher & Co. officer Richard C. Cary, the Controller and Chief Accounting Officer, reported selling 1,000 shares of common stock on September 15, 2026 at $252.8583 per share, leaving 46,819.487 shares held directly. He also reports indirect holdings through a 401(k) plan and multiple equity-based awards, including stock options, notional stock units and phantom stock. No Rule 10b5-1 trading plan is reported for this sale.

A non-qualified stock option (NSO) is a contract that lets an employee or service provider buy company shares at a fixed price for a set period, like a voucher to purchase stock later at today’s price. It matters to investors because exercising NSOs creates ordinary income for the holder and can increase share count, affecting a company’s earnings and ownership mix; think of it as a future sale that can dilute existing shareholders and has immediate tax consequences for the recipient.

A phantom stock is a form of compensation that gives employees or executives the benefits of stock ownership, such as the increase in stock value, without actually giving them real shares. It acts like a promise to pay the employee the equivalent value of company stock later, often as a bonus or incentive. This allows companies to motivate and reward staff without diluting ownership or transferring actual shares.
